The dragonstone ring (i) is an upgraded version of the regular dragonstone ring. It can be imbued as a reward from the Soul Wars minigame. The player must provide the dragonstone ring to Zimberfizz or Zanik. The cost of doing so is 5 zeal.

Even if you have an onyx ring (i), there are occasions where the imbued dragonstone ring is recommended as despite having lower stats, it costs less. Choosing this ring allows you to take another expensive piece of equipment, without risking it.

Trivia

edit
  • The dragonstone ring (i) was formerly obtained by providing a dragonstone ring to one of the officers in the Officers' Tower while having 141,300 reward credits and 200+ rank from the Mobilising Armies minigame.
